$cUrl = curl_init();
curl_setopt($cUrl, CURLOPT_URL, 'google.com');
curl_setopt($cUrl,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($cUrl, CURLOPT_HTTPPROXYTUNNEL, 1);
curl_setopt($this->cUrl, CURLOPT_PROXY, '80.91.116.93:3128');
curl_setopt($this->cUrl, CURLOPT_PROXYUSERPWD, 'username:password');
$PageContent = curl_exec($cUrl);
curl_close($cUrl);
<?php
$ch = curl_init("http://majidonline.com/");
$fp = fopen("majidonline.htm", "w");
curl_setopt($ch, CURLOPT_FILE, $fp);
curl_setopt($ch, CURLOPT_HEADER, 0);
curl_exec($ch);
curl_close($ch);
fclose($fp);
?>
چی میگه؟ممنون آقای شاه کلید.
این کد رو از php.net پیدا کردم ، اما خطا میده. میشه بگید کجاش اشتباهه؟
آی پی و پورت بهش دادم ، اما کار نمیکنه. در ضمن ، خط بعدش ، یوزر نیم و پسورد برای چی هست؟PHP:$cUrl = curl_init(); curl_setopt($cUrl, CURLOPT_URL, 'google.com'); curl_setopt($cUrl, CURLOPT_RETURNTRANSFER, 1); curl_setopt($cUrl, CURLOPT_HTTPPROXYTUNNEL, 1); curl_setopt($this->cUrl, CURLOPT_PROXY, '80.91.116.93:3128'); curl_setopt($this->cUrl, CURLOPT_PROXYUSERPWD, 'username:password'); $PageContent = curl_exec($cUrl); curl_close($cUrl);
<?php
function download_pretending($url,$user_agent) {
$ch = curl_init();
curl_setopt ($ch, CURLOPT_URL, $url);
curl_setopt ($ch, CURLOPT_USERAGENT, $user_agent);
curl_setopt ($ch, CURLOPT_HEADER, 0);
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
$result = curl_exec ($ch);
curl_close ($ch);
return $result;
}
echo download_pretending("http://www.yahoo.com", "Internet Explorer");
?>